If you are getting ready to put items into a self-storage unit, it is important to carefully pack up the items you will be placed in the storage unit. The proper packing is essential to preserve the integrity of your belongings.
Smart Tip #1: Use Similar Sized Boxes
First, it is smart to use similar-sized boxes to pack up all your items. Stick to one to three different-sized boxes. Using similar-sized boxes will make it easier for you to stack boxes up and make the most of your space.
